    Why is my Beko BBVCM 180 Air Conditioner not cooling properly?

      If your Beko Air Conditioner isn't cooling well, several factors could be at play. The temperature setting might be too high, so try lowering it. Dirty heat exchangers on either the indoor or outdoor unit can also cause this, so clean them. Check the air filter and clean it if dirty. Ensure that the air inlet and outlet aren't blocked; if they are, turn off the unit, remove the obstruction, and turn it back on. Keep doors and windows closed during operation and close curtains to reduce heat from sunlight. Reduce the number of heat sources in the room, and have a professional check for refrigerant leaks, reseal if necessary, and top off the refrigerant. Finally, if the SILENCE function is activated, turn it off as it can reduce performance.

    What to do if my Beko BBVCM 180 is not working?

      If your Beko Air Conditioner isn't working, first, ensure that there isn't a power failure and that the power is turned on. Check the fuse and replace it if it's burned out. Replace the remote control batteries if they're dead. If the unit's 3-minute protection has been activated, wait three minutes after restarting it. Finally, make sure the timer is turned off.

    Why does my Beko BBVCM 180 Air Conditioner start and stop frequently?

      If your Beko Air Conditioner starts and stops frequently, it could be due to several reasons. There might be too much or too little refrigerant in the system, so check for leaks and recharge the system. Incompressible gas or moisture might have entered the system, requiring you to evacuate and recharge it with refrigerant. The compressor could be broken, necessitating a replacement. Lastly, the voltage might be too high or too low; in this case, install a manostat to regulate the voltage.
